Publication Order of Hail Raisers Books

The Hail Raisers series is a renowned series of contemporary, romance, humor, and funny stories. It is comprised of a total of 6 books, which were released between the years 2017 and 2018. The series is written by a bestselling American writer named Lani Lynn Vale. In each of the books of this series, author Vale has mentioned a different set of primary characters. Some of the most important characters depicted by her include Evander Lennox, Kennedy Swallow, Travis, Allegra, Hannah, Hennessy Hanes, Tate Casey, Baylor, Lark, Reed Hail, Krisney Shaw, Mary Persephone Hail, Dante, etc. The settings of most of the plots of the series is done in Texas. The debut book of the Hail Raisers series is entitled ‘Hail No’. It was released as a Kindle edition in the year 2017. This novel’s story revolves around the lives of the chief characters named Kennedy Swallow and Evander Lennox. At the beginning of the book’s story, it is depicted that Evander Lennox does not like to do things that he does not want to. This attitude of Evander begins to change when he gets imprisoned. In the 4 years that he was in prison, he didn’t have any choice than doing the things that was asked to do and when he was told to do those things. Now, the situation has become so that if Evander Lennox doesn’t do a thing is ordered to, he will be sent to hell again and won’t get a chance to return. After getting released from prison, Evander gets his previous job back within 24 hours. He also gets back his dog and his home. But, he realizes that people around him are not as forgiving as they used to be. Evander almost gives up the hope of integrating into the social life again when a lady comes knocking at his heart, figuratively and literally.

Kennedy Swallow appears to be a woman who just wishes to feel belonged. She has seen the divorce of her parents at a very young age. Also, Kennedy separated from her only sibling, a twin. Fifteen years later, Kennedy Swallow gets the chance to meet her family and fulfill her dream of being a part of it. In order to make this dream come true, Kennedy leaves her behind her old life and relocates to the town of Hostel in Texas. Just when Kennedy thinks that she has started to make progress in gaining back the trust of her family, she learns about the illness of her twin. And it breaks her heart to find out that the reason behind her family’s acceptance of her is having someone for free to take care of her twin whenever the need arises. Kennedy Swallow goes through several eye-opening experiences and finally understands that she is just being used. She vows to herself that she is going to use this situation to its fullest. Kennedy becomes firm as a rock, preventing herself from having any kind of emotion. But, what she doesn’t prepare herself for is the arrival of a man like Evander Lennox in her life, who forces her to have soft feelings again.

As soon as Evander sees Kennedy lying on the ground with blood coming out of her jaw, he realizes that life is not as bad as it appears to be. Evander senses that Kennedy has an obsession with chickens, thrill for an eventful life, and a wish for being wanted. Having her around brings a lot of changes in Evander Lennox. But, for Kennedy, it works the other way. The town’s people start judging her as guilty just for being in the company of Evander. Subsequently, Kennedy Swallow’s business starts to suffer. This makes her realize that she will end up losing everything she has worked very hard for if she continues to be with him. However, she decides not to leave him in spite of this. But, Evander doesn’t wish to let another person suffer because of him. So, he breaks it to Kennedy that he will separate from him. Kennedy is determined not to let him go, so she makes it clear to him that she willing to fight any battle of life as long as he is beside her. He realizes leaving her will be a big mistake, and continues to cherish a life full of love and romance with her.

Another entertaining book written as a part of this series is called ‘Burn in Hail’. It was also published in 2017. This novel consists of the central characters as Hennessy Hanes and Tate Casey. At the start of the story of the book, it is shown that just by looking once at the 16 year old prim & proper Hennessy Hanes, Tate Casey sense he is trouble. Hennessy is the daughter of the town’s preacher, and Tate knows he has to keep a safe distance from her. But, he sees something in her that keeps drawing him towards her. The more Tate Casey knows about Hennessy, the more he suspects something is not right. And when he is unable to make out what the thing is, he becomes determined to discover what is it that makes him suspect the haunted-eyed girl. Tate’s investigation makes it clear that there is someone else determined to prevent Hennessy’s secret from getting unraveled. Fearing to land himself in trouble or in prison, Tate decides to move away as far as possible from the girl and the town. But, this doesn’t help his cause as he cannot stop having the memories of Hanes.

Hennessy is not able to tell anyone that her preacher father abuses her. When she cannot take the abuses anymore, she runs away leaving her family and town behind. Hennessy and Tate meet again after 10 years. She sees that Tate has not changed much. He still shows a lot of anger that is unable to control. The court orders him to seek help in improving this condition. Knowing that Tate tried to save her in the past, she feels it is her duty to return the favor. Hennessy decides to help Tate in managing his anger and preventing him from going back to prison. The two realize that they were always meant to be together, but they had become victims of the adverse situation. But now, they have nothing to worry about. Hennessy is willing to break any rule to get Tate back in her life again. He too seems equally determined to make her a permanent part of his life.
